September 28, 200618 yr http://www.magicbus.com.br/images/fuxicos/135146001150552706.jpg Website & Teaser Trailer Plot Michael Bay has confirmed that the movie starts out with a battle on Cybertron. It then moves to the Arctic Circle during the 1800s where Captain Archibald Witwicky is shown chipping away at a massive sheet of ice, only to break through it and fall into the abyss on the other side. Witwicky lands on a robotic hand partially buried in the ice, and looks up to find the eyes of Megatron staring back at him. Megatron burns a map showing the location of the mysterious "Allspark" into Witwicky's eyeglasses, which are handed down to his descendant, Sam (Shia LaBeouf), in the present day. When Witwicky buys his first car from dealer Bobby Bolivia (Bernie Mac), it transpires that it is the Autobot, Bumblebee, and Witwicky comes under the protection of the Autobots as the Decepticons come looking for the map. Ain't It Cool News reports that an early scene in the film will feature the giant robotic scorpion Decepticon, Scorponok, attacking a Middle Eastern Army base in the present day. The "Allspark" has also been referred to as both the "Energon Cube" and the "Energon Crystal"; the earliest description credited it as "responsible for Transformer life on Earth." Per the words of LaBeouf in a recent interview, this appears to mean that it possesses the power to bring to life ordinary machines, turning them into Transformers too. In this respect, it is similar to the Creation Matrix of the original Transformers comics. The engine of Sam, for the film, essentially he is the liaison between the robots and the humans. The government is too closed minded to conceive of a reality like this, of alien machines... it's just too much. So, they bestow power upon these people who are experts at their crafts, whether it be the technician or the Dogs of War, or the braintrust who is able to communicate with the robots. And the reason Sam is able to communicate with the robots... It's not because he knows some ****in' alien language. Sam Whitwicky comes from a lineage of explorers. Captain Archibald Whitwicky was his great, great grandfather, a 19th Century Seaman, who, during a search, an exploration of the arctic circle, fell upon an ice cave. Fell into the ice cave and into a hand; the hand of Megatron. What he saw when he turned was an eye which burned a laser into his eyeglasses, which was a map of where the Energon Cube is being stored. When Optimus and the Autobots come to Earth, they're looking for the same thing the Decepticons, obviously. The way that they get there is the map on the glasses. Who has the glasses? Sam has the glasses. So, he becomes the liaison between them and their goal. I'm the middle man. QUINT: There's also an element of protection, as well. They protect you from the Decepticons.
